
An Oxford-based startup has turned to crowd-funding to help develop Zap&Go, a phone charger with an emphasis on speed and portability. Thanks to a graphene super-capacitor and an ad-hoc power supply, the device will reportedly charge to its 1,500-mAh capacity – enough to fully charge an iPhone 5s – in only five minutes and promises to be a much more practical solution than current alternatives, particularly when traveling.
